Job description
Overview

Mobile Electrical Engineer – Birmingham based, covering Birmingham and Nottingham sites. Salary up to £42,000 per annum plus call out and overtime. Mon–Fri, 40 hours per week (days). Van supplied and fuel card included.

Responsibilities
  • Undertake planned and reactive maintenance tasks on electrical systems.
  • Cover maintenance of lighting, emergency systems, and building services plant room electrical systems.
  • Complete PPMs in line with SLA and KPI agreements.
  • Respond to Helpdesk requests, providing a professional and timely service.
  • Support other members of the maintenance team with ad-hoc tasks across all disciplines.
  • Basic mechanical and fabric tasks where required.
  • Compliance checks.
  • Small works projects.
Skills & Background
  • Recognised professional engineering qualification, Level 3.
  • Willing to complete general building services and plant maintenance.
  • 18th edition.
  • Proven building maintenance experience within a commercial environment.
  • Presentable and reliable.
  • Valid Driving license.
On Offer

Permanent position, basic salary up to £42,000 per annum, plus van and 22 days annual leave plus statutory holidays. Weekly on-call payment of £50 per week (£2,600 per year on top of salary). To date there have been no call-outs on this contract.
